Output cf3a53a1df75571f8864f299952896e5cf19379a9ed886e01c81d200a329acb2:0

value
9398400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70d114a9c38fe127f1d51cd8bbd5374f8720857a OP_EQUAL
address
3ByY5DDtbYJXJAf5wbEzhkELjUWS66K9xH
transaction
cf3a53a1df75571f8864f299952896e5cf19379a9ed886e01c81d200a329acb2
confirmations
507389
spent
true